
From a profile of James Wood, my favorite contemporary literary critic, about writing for The New Yorker:
His only other peeve is the way the magazine treats the semi-colon. "The New Yorker will try as often as possible to change it into a colon," he says - ascribing it to an attempt to mimic English properness. "I love semi-colons," he says with all the enthusiasm of a 10-year-old talking about chocolate.I couldn't agree more.
